Tools from the video and more resources can be found on this twilio blog po. Before continuing on, you may want to read the official documentation for this feature, as understanding this will make the documentation below significantly easier to follow. Anaconda community open source numfocus support developer blog. In this tutorial, we are going to use twilio along with frinkiac, the simpons quote and screencap database, to create a python app that will automatically send us a simpsons screencap and quote every day via mms. Also, you must mark snippets with the twilioclient version that is used in that particular snippet. Collection of api reference documentation for twilio apis.
How to use twilio for voice and sms python microsoft docs. We show a collection of python quickstarts for twilio products, including voice, sms, video, and our browser voip client. Once the app is up and running, check out the home page to see which demos you can run. One thing, in particular, is hacking together code to develop and deploy simple web apps for particular functions or utilities you may need in your business. Text messages are one of the best communication methods for sending time sensitive information or asking users to take immediate action. I built the sms bot using the twilio api and python, which allows you to send a twilio number messages and get answers back. Utilizing twilio, upon receiving any sms im seeking to trigger a python function that reads the contents of the message, then conditionally performs an action. Twilio python quickstarts heres weve included a number of python quickstarts and guides to get started with sms, voice, and other communications programatically.
The documentation for the twilio api can be found here the python library documentation can be found here versions. Install from pypi using pip, a package manager for python. Google app engine customers receive complimentary credit for sms messages or inbound minutes when you upgrade. Or, you can download the source code zip for twiliopython, and then run. Here are your first steps to get started using the bottle web application framework with the python programming language. Take the docs for a spin and get building in python fast. The same source code archive can also be used to build the windows and mac versions, and is the starting point for ports to all other platforms. If youre new to azure functions, start with the following resources. The twilio python helper library supports python applications written in python 2.
The source code is hosted on github, which includes a wiki that contains complete documentation for using the libraries by default, microsoft visual studio 2010 installs version 1. To download an archive containing all the documents for this version of python in one of various formats, follow one of links in this table. Jun 09, 2017 quantum computing explained with a deck of cards dario gil, ibm research duration. The twilio platform consists of the twilio markup language twiml, a restful api, and voip sdks for web browsers, android, and ios. Net, and twilio to receive and download images and other media on incoming mms messages. A python module for communicating with the twilio api and generating twiml. For a full tutorial, check out either of the python authy quickstarts in our docs. Please refer to current documentation for guidance. By default, incoming callers will hear a message saying that you have reached a twilio line, while incoming messages will receive an sms response. For example, a java snippet that uses twiliojava v7. Twilio python quickstarts for sms, voice and more twilio. Serverless phone number validation with aws lambda, python and twilio walks through using the python runtime on aws lambda and twilio s apis for validating phone number information. This talk will walk through the twilio service, sign up process, api, python library, and how to easily integrate it into your application. Additionally, there is a new additional installer variant for macos 10.
How to set up twilio for gae using windows7 stack overflow. The python tag on the twilio blog provides walkthroughs for django, flask and bottle apps to learn from while building your own projects. Try the twilio python helper library, our sdk which helps you quickly build. You will learn how to use command promptterminal, how to set up and host a server, and how to manipulate strings and then query data from different apis.
The following command will install the latest version of a module and its dependencies from the python packaging index. Python setup and usage how to use python on different platforms. Twilio is an api for developers to add communications such as phone calling, messaging and. Cannot install twilio package with anaconda python3. Here is a simple example of how the php helper library can be used to download data a csv of sms your records. This can be modified by routing your phone number to a twilio application you build. This is reference information for azure functions developers. Please consult the official migration guide for information on upgrading your application using. For example, you might send email to confirm business transactions, confirm the creation of user accounts, or send marketing communications. With just a few lines of code, your python application can make and receive phone calls with twilio programmable voice this python quickstart will teach you how to do this using our rest api, the twilio python helper library, and pythons flask microframework to ease development. You can configure your application to use the twilio library for python in two ways. This page of the python tutorial shows exactly where i need help. Jak pouzivat twilio pro hlas a sms python microsoft docs. If idle is already open, you need to close and reopen it.
Code snippets, tutorials, and sample apps for common use cases and communications solutions. To make things more efficient, we have used the same python ingredients time and time again so you only need to go through environmental setup one time. These are the fastest path to a working demo, and by the end youll have working code that you can expand into the next big communications application. Guides and quickstarts for integrating twilio products and services into your web or mobile app. How is twilios documentation for python developers. We are going to accomplish this in less than 40 lines of python.
Tutorial using a raspberry pi, python, iot, twilio, bluemix ibm. In this tutorial we are going to go through how to integrate a python flask webapp in bluemix with the internet of things foundation in bluemix with a raspberry pi and two sensors on the raspberry pi. This repo contains the code for allready, an opensource solution focused on increasing awareness, efficiency and impact of preparedness campaigns as they are delivered by humanitarian and disaster response organizations in local communities. Though this project may seem daunting at first, do not worry. Installing twilio on windows to confirm your twilio installation, reopen idle. Composer clarification for the composition creation documentation. Django twilio makes it easy to use twilio in your django projects. Your new twilio phone number can now receive incoming calls and sms messages. How to receive an sms in python with twilio youtube. The libraries can be installed using the nuget package manager extension available for visual studio 2010 up to 2015. Configure your application to use twilio libraries. Open command prompt, type python m pip install twilio without quotes.
Im trying to download all the media that is sent to my twilio account and cannot for the life of me figure out how to access the actual images. Configure this module by specifying the name of a configuration profile in the minion config, minion pillar, or master config. The bolt python library provides an easy interface to send email and sms alerts using mailgun and twilio thirdparty services respectively. Code snippets for the twilio api documentation github. The most recent version of the library can be found on pypi. This sample project demonstrates how to use twilio apis in a python web application. Most twilio tutorials have idiomatic python versions with entire open source applications in. Jak pouzivat twilio pro hlasove a sms schopnosti v pythonu how to use twilio for voice and sms capabilities in python. Sdks in popular web languages and examples and full reference documentation for the sms api.
You are viewing docs for the latest stable release, 3000. With just a few lines of code, your python application can make and receive phone calls with twilio programmable voice this python quickstart will teach you how to do this using our rest api, the twilio python helper library, and python s flask microframework to ease development in this quickstart, you will learn how to. Everything you need to develop using twilio programmable sms. Twilio sms python simple send a message stack overflow. Getting started with the twilio api couldnt be easier. How is twilio s documentation for python developers.
Documentation on using rapidsms twilio is available on read the docs. The documentation for the twilio api can be found here. Distributing python modules publishing modules for installation by others. If you are looking for metrics, reporting, data analysis, etc.
You took your time with the call, i took no time with the fall, you gave me nothing at all. More on how to choose between authy and verify here. For most unix systems, you must download and compile the source code. I am just lost and cant find any concrete examples in the documentation. Quantum computing explained with a deck of cards dario gil, ibm research duration. Take the docs for a spin and get building in python fast docs. With a free twilio account, you only get to text verified numbers. Firstly, download and install the djangotwilio package. The twilio python helper library makes it easy to interact with the twilio api from your python application. Mar 03, 2020 python 2 applications on app engine can use thirdparty companies to send email, sms messages, or make and receive phone calls. Snippets should use placeholders for user information in a format that resembles the original value. Quickstarts, guides, sample code and tutorials for many use cases. Youll find examples for chat, video, sync, and more lets get started.
This guide demonstrates how to perform common programming tasks with the twilio api service on azure. The python library documentation can be found here. Azure functions supports output bindings for twilio. The official twilio python library provides a really awesome wrapper around twilio s rest api. How to use twilio for voice and sms capabilities in python. Mar 31, 2020 this is important because the language will be visible on the docs. Please consult the official migration guide for information on upgrading your application using twiliopython 5. This guide demonstrates how to perform common programming tasks with the twilio. By continuing to use pastebin, you agree to our use of cookies as described in the cookies policy. Twilio is a developerfocused company, rather than a traditional enterprise company, so their tutorials and documentation are written by developers for fellow developers. In order to code along with this post youll want to start with the following.
Twilio makes sending short message service sms messages easy with a few lines of code. Jan 09, 2020 if you only need sms and voice support for onetime passwords, we recommend using the twilio verify api instead. This project aims to keep compatibility with the supported django releases. Iot python app with a raspberry pi and bluemix this is an extensioncontinuation from the blog post on how to create a basic python webapp. Until that happens, we can build a tool that will help us identify a robocall with a bit of python, the twilio lookup api, and the nomorobo spam score addon. If you are going to be downloading lots of data from the twilio api, we highly suggest that you use one of the official twilio helper libraries to do this. To download an archive containing all the documents for this version of python in one.
Using twilio to send sms texts via python, flask, and ngrok. Receive and download images on incoming mms messages. To install this package with conda run one of the following. Python howtos indepth documents on specific topics. As such our versions of python and django are designed to match that cadence as much as possible. Receive and download images on incoming mms messages with python and django twilio twilio docs. Gallery about documentation support about anaconda, inc.
1328 1334 1305 591 233 672 87 1166 1666 322 154 490 954 437 893 1146 1366 1650 996 283 201 1376 984 304 526 617 1450 245 1208 560 1035 761 841 1095 1116 646 824 1025 467 338 491